According to Grips Intelligence data tracking five major retailers from January to February 2026, Gpx maintains an average product price of $35.33 across its portfolio. Amazon dominates as the brand's primary sales channel, commanding 47.1% of total revenue share, followed by Lowes.com at 31.6%, with the remaining share split among Ace Hardware, Home Depot, and Menards. Notably, the brand experienced a significant 55.1% decline in overall revenue during the tracked period, signaling potential challenges in market demand or distribution. Despite the revenue downturn, Gpx's average price saw a 12.6% month-over-month increase, suggesting a possible shift toward higher-priced product sales or strategic pricing adjustments. These trends indicate that while Gpx is consolidating around key retail partners like Amazon and Lowe's, the brand faces headwinds in sustaining its revenue momentum heading into 2026.
